7-day Adventure Itinerary in Mumbai

  1. Day 1: Trek to Lohagad Fort
    2 hours (64 km) from Mumbai

    Begin your adventure with a trek to Lohagad Fort, a hill fort offering breathtaking views and a glimpse into the Maratha Empire's history. Morning departure recommended for optimal weather conditions. Afternoon, explore the fort and enjoy a picnic. Evening, return to Mumbai and have a traditional Indian dinner at Bademiya, famous for its kebabs.

  2. Day 2: Scuba Diving in Konkan
    3 hours and 30 minutes (170 km) from Mumbai

    Get your adrenaline pumping by experiencing the underwater world of Konkan. Morning departure recommended for optimal visibility. Afternoon, enjoy a seafood lunch at a local restaurant. Evening, visit the Gateway of India, an iconic landmark in Mumbai, and take a relaxing boat ride to Elephanta Caves,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

  3. Day 3: Paragliding in Kamshet
    2 hours (110 km) from Mumbai

    Experience the thrill of flying in the sky with paragliding in Kamshet, a popular destination for adventure sports. Morning departure recommended for optimal weather conditions. Afternoon, explore the nearby villages and have a local lunch. Evening, relax at your hotel and enjoy the sunset.

  4. Day 4: Rafting in Kolad
    3 hours (125 km) from Mumbai

    Get your heart racing with rafting in Kolad, a small village surrounded by lush greenery and waterfalls. Morning departure recommended for optimal water level. Afternoon, have a local lunch at a riverside restaurant. Evening, explore the nearby Kundalika River and go for a nature walk.

  5. Day 5: Camping in Lonavala
    1 hour and 45 minutes (66 km) from Mumbai

    Experience the beauty of nature by camping in Lonavala, a hill station known for its scenic views and waterfalls. Morning departure recommended for optimal weather conditions. Afternoon, have a local lunch and explore the nearby Rajmachi Point. Evening, have a campfire and enjoy stargazing.

  6. Day 6: Bungee Jumping in Lonavala
    1 hour and 45 minutes (66 km) from Mumbai

    Get your adrenaline pumping by bungee jumping in Lonavala, a popular destination for adventure sports. Morning departure recommended for optimal weather conditions. Afternoon, have a local lunch and explore the nearby Bhushi Dam. Evening, return to Mumbai and have a dinner at Shree Thaker Bhojanalay, a traditional Gujarati restaurant.

  7. Day 7: Trek to Harishchandragad Fort
    4 hours and 30 minutes (180 km) from Mumbai

    End your adventure with a trek to Harishchandragad Fort, a hill fort known for its natural beauty and historical significance. Morning departure recommended for optimal weather conditions. Afternoon, explore the nearby Kedareshwar Cave and have a picnic. Evening, return to Mumbai and go for some souvenir shopping at Crawford Market.

Time and Costs Estimates

  • Lohagad Fort Trek (6 hours, Rs. 500)
  • Scuba Diving in Konkan (4 hours, Rs. 3500)
  • Paragliding in Kamshet (5 hours, Rs. 3000)
  • Rafting in Kolad (6 hours, Rs. 1500)
  • Camping in Lonavala (24 hours, Rs. 2000)
  • Bungee Jumping in Lonavala (4 hours, Rs. 2500)
  • Trek to Harishchandragad Fort (8 hours, Rs. 800)
  • Total Estimated Costs: Rs. 13500
